When Pluto was officially demoted from planet to "dwarf planet" status in 2006, astrophysicist Neil deGrasse Tyson caught a lot of flak. The exhibit at the Hayden Planetarium didn't classify Pluto the same way it classified other planets . b. looked impressive. "We wanted to be sure that the exhibits had high shelf life," he says, adding that the exhibit was a $250,000 investment. That's what led us to organize the solar system as like properties rather than as an enumeration of cosmic objects, as it's so commonly taught in school. 4.
